The Rivers State Commissioner of Police, Olatunji Disu, has assured the people of the state that the crisis enveloping the Local Government Areas (LGAs) will not be allowed to lead to a breakdown of law and order.
CP Disu gave the assurance while speaking with journalists at the police headquarters in Port Harcourt on Monday.
According to him, the police are aware of the situation at the different LGAs and expect the different political players to respect the appeal and cease hostilities pending the hearing and determination of their case.
CP Disu warned that his men are equal to the task of securing the different council headquarters and won’t tolerate any attempt to disturb the peace in the state.
